### OpenAI's GPT-4o: The New Multimodal Powerhouse

OpenAI has raised the bar once again with **GPT-4o**, a truly versatile multimodal AI system capable of generating and understanding **text**, **video**, **audio**, and impressively **realistic images**. This successor to **DALL-E 3** marks a significant leap forward in AI capabilities and is now available to all ChatGPT users across various subscription tiers.

What sets GPT-4o apart is its extensive refinement through reinforcement learning from human feedback ***(RLHF)***, resulting in improved accuracy across modalities.

The model excels at creating lifelike images, coherent text, and even transparent backgrounds for logos and presentation slides – a feature that will undoubtedly appeal to design professionals and marketers alike.

However, it's worth noting that despite these impressive advancements, users have reported occasional inaccuracies in reproducing specific image elements. This suggests that while the technology has made tremendous strides, there's still room for improvement.

### Google's Gemini 2.5: The Reasoning Champion

Google has unveiled **Gemini 2.5 Pro**, an advanced AI model emphasizing enhanced reasoning and multimodal processing abilities. This model is designed to handle complex tasks by integrating text, images, and other data forms, providing context-rich outputs. It has demonstrated superior performance on various AI benchmarks, surpassing competitors like OpenAI and Anthropic in areas such as coding, mathematics, and science.

One notable feature of **Gemini 2.5 Pro** is its “**thinking**” capability, which allows the model to process tasks step-by-step, delivering more informed and accurate responses, particularly for intricate prompts. A demonstration showcased the AI's ability to program a video game from a single prompt, highlighting its refined reasoning skills. Additionally, Google plans to expand the model's context window to 2 million tokens, enabling it to handle more extensive data inputs effectively.

Gemini 2.5 Pro is currently available in an experimental state through the Gemini Advanced plan and Google AI Studio, with broader access anticipated in the near future. ​

### Anthropic's Claude 3.7 Sonnet: The Workplace Assistant

Anthropic has introduced **Claude 3.7 Sonnet**, a “**hybrid reasoning model**” designed to excel in solving complex problems, particularly in mathematics and coding. This model integrates reasoning as a core feature, simplifying user interactions and enhancing its applicability in various domains.

A significant advancement in Claude 3.7 Sonnet is its “extended thinking” mode, which allows users to choose between near-instant responses and more deliberate, step-by-step reasoning. This flexibility is particularly beneficial for tasks requiring thorough analysis and detailed solutions. In practical applications, Claude 3.7 Sonnet has been utilized to enhance web designs, develop games, and perform substantial coding tasks, demonstrating its versatility as a workplace assistant. ​

Furthermore, Anthropic has expanded Claude's capabilities to the enterprise sector through a partnership with Databricks. This collaboration aims to assist over **10,000 companies** in creating specialized AI agents tailored to their specific needs, thereby broadening the impact of Claude 3.7 Sonnet in various professional contexts.
